Beyond Addiction Weekly Column

Check out Beyond Addiction a weekly column written by William C. Moyers, vice president of external affairs for the Hazelden Foundation and the author of "Broken," a best-selling memoir. His most recent topic is, "Disparity and Despair" in which he discusses the feedback he got on a previous column about marijuana. He "made these three key points: It is a mood- and mind-altering drug; it is illegal; and for some people, it causes serious consequences, including addiction."

The other side of the coin is overcrowded prisons and courts. "The drug war gets results. But it has done almost nothing to reduce the problems caused by legal and illegal drugs mainly because it has consistently failed to recognize and promote a solution that works: prevention, treatment and recovery for people who possess and use these substances."
